(CEP News) - Japanese data dominates the macroeconomic landscape on Thursday evening with CPI figures at the forefront.
Tokyo CPI for June, excluding food and energy, is expected to increase 0.2% from year-ago levels. Meanwhile, the headline index is expected to increase 1.2%. The annualized core CPI for May at the national level is expected to come in flat. Economists at Barclays Capital expect the nationwide CPI excluding perishables (core CPI) to rise 1.4% year-over-year in May, up from the April reading of 0.9%, due largely to the reinstatement of the provisional gasoline tax, which had temporarily expired in April. The Japanese jobless rate for May is expected to come in at 4.0%, as it did in April. Friday morning, Reserve Bank of Australia Assistant Governor Guy Debelle is set to speak in Sydney at the Australia Debt Markets Conference on the subject of 'Open Markets Operations'.
